Primitive Swedish Chair in Remnants of Original Red Paint
About the Item
Primitive Swedish chair in remnants of original red paint, circa 1820. Decorative Scandinavian-style carved back.
- Dimensions:Height: 27 in (68.58 cm)Width: 13 in (33.02 cm)Depth: 16 in (40.64 cm)
- Style:Primitive (In the Style Of)
- Materials and Techniques:
- Place of Origin:
- Period:
- Date of Manufacture:Circa 1810-1829
- Condition:Repaired: Joints tightened. Wear consistent with age and use. Minor losses. Minor fading. Wear consistent with age and use. Pegged construction with mortise and tenon joinery in backrest. Joints all tightened. Stable and sturdy. Losses to original - or early - painted finish.
